summaryrefslogtreecommitdiffstats
path: root/kpat/freecell-solver/CMakeLists.txt
blob: b40359c7b179ecc30554d321c026b2b35769c6e6 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
# This file is genereted by trinity-automake-cmake-convert script by Fat-Zer

include_directories(
  ${CMAKE_BINARY_DIR}
  ${CMAKE_CURRENT_BINARY_DIR}
  ${CMAKE_CURRENT_SOURCE_DIR}
  ${TDE_INCLUDE_DIR}
  ${TQT_INCLUDE_DIRS}
)

link_directories(
  ${TQT_LIBRARY_DIRS}
)

add_definitions(
  -DFCS_STATE_STORAGE=FCS_STATE_STORAGE_INTERNAL_HASH
  -DFCS_STACK_STORAGE=FCS_STACK_STORAGE_INTERNAL_HASH
)


##### fcs (static) ##############################

tde_add_library( fcs STATIC_PIC AUTOMOC
  SOURCES alloc.c app_str.c caas.c card.c cl_chop.c cmd_line.c fcs_dm.c
    fcs_hash.c fcs_isa.c freecell.c intrface.c lib.c lookup2.c move.c pqueue.c
    preset.c rand.c scans.c simpsim.c state.c
)